Seems to be a common problem this month, we have exactly the same problem, drove it, stopped on Christmas day for 5 mins (on a slight uphil if that makes a difference) got back in and it wouldn't start.Engine management light doesn't show, computer doesn't show an error, it cranks OK, fuel gets to the injectors but the injectors don't trigger.
Suspicion is something in the electronics (ecu or a sensor) but without replacing everything in in turn until we find the answer we don't know how to solve it.
Might a Fiat dealer have further diagnostic equipment or will they be stumped as well as the engine management light doesn't show?
If you work out the solution I'd love to know and I'll let you know if we work it out first!
John
healeyowners at dsl dot pipex dot com